This year, Lawn & Garden Retailer is sponsoring Lawn & Garden World at the show. “We are thrilled to have Lawn & Garden Retailer as our partner for the 2007 Lawn & Garden World,” said Rob Cappiello, industry vice president, National Hardware Show. “Lawn & Garden World, together with Lawn & Garden Retailer , will help the independent retailer enhance their businesses through insight, trends, new unique products and the latest business information to stay on top.”
The National Hardware Show, along with the co-located Gourmet Housewares Show, currently attracts more than 750 housewares retailers, according to the NHS. Lawn & Garden World should have more than 1,000 exhibitors.
Homewares Show Debuts
In response to top retailers’ growing sales in the housewares category, the new Homewares Show will debut this year alongside the 2007 National Hardware Show. The Homewares Show was created to provide a time-saving, efficient way for manufacturers to connect with retail buying customers and prospects.
Bringing The Indoors Out
Outdoor spaces have become as important as the kitchen and living room, and today’s consumers want to furnish and decorate them with as much care as they do their indoor spaces. According to the National Gardening Association, sales for lawn and garden products totaled $36.8 billion in 2005.
Some of the outdoor living top trends being showcased at the 2007 Hardware Show include:
- Front yard landscaping
- Container gardening
- New-and-improved decks and patios
- Exterior lighting
- Outdoor fireplaces
- Garden pavilions and gazebos
- Sight and sound enhanced fountains
Preview Party
The National Hardware Show’s creators offered a sneak peek into a few new products for 50 consumer media members in a home-themed preview party last November in New York City. “We were thrilled with the terrific response from exhibitors and media alike,” said Beth Blake, PR director for the National Hardware Show.
Sixteen manufacturers presented new home, hardware and outdoor products to be seen in 2007. These manufacturers represented the depth of product categories in home improvement that will be exhibited at the NHS.
Lower Costs
The 2004 National Hardware Show was the first to pick up drayage cost for exhibitors (costs associated with delivering materials to booth). The 2007 show will continue to offer this benefit.
